The survey is very important. I gave bad survey on Lexus of smithtown and it got back to the dealership. The dealership deduct the sales person's bonus for that month. So it does goes back to Lexus and to the dealership for customer satisfaction and dealership grading.
I had pleasant Lexus experience so far, except on the delivery and the sales guy. My GS350 was delivered to me with underinflated tires ( 28 psi ), dirty windows. Took me Two visits to fix the tire warnings system. When I put this on the survey, the sales guy has the nerve to call me and complain that he is not going to get his next bonus because of this and how he wish he never sold me the car. I complain to his Manager and to the dealership.
In summary use the survey to indicate your feelings.

The survey affects a dealership. When i bought my gs it had been sitting on the lot a while, after driving the car around i noticed something wasnt right and brought it to the local dealer (not the one i bought the car from) They told me i needed new tires. I then brought the car back to where i bought it and they didnt want to give me new tires and claimed nothing was wrong with them. I told them i hope their right because im going to bring it to Townfaire tires for a third opinion. Then all of a sudden they have a meeting in the back with the service manager, my service rep and someone else with a high position. Long story short the services manager tells me that they will replace 3 of the tires and use the spare in my trunk as a forth. After the service rep tells me that he told them in the meeting that i might fill out the survey bad and that thier dealership is soo close to ELITE status they should make me happy in hopes of a good survey. I said i would but i had already gave a ****y survey over the phone. Anyway i recieved one in the mail the next week and filled it out good. Then they sent me a free thumus and two lexus coffee mugs as a thank you. The crome Lexus thurmus i really like.
Dealers with Elite status get things before other lexus dealers like a ls460 on the showroom floor and other dealer perks.
